9 - To check the wear in the compression rings, insert
them one at a time into the cylinder (25) by about
10-15 mm and measure the gap between the two
ends with a feeler gauge (28); the rings must be
replaced if the gap is more than 0.8 mm.
NOTE - If a gap of more than 0.4 mm is measu-
red with new rings it means that the cylinder is
worn beyond the acceptable limits and must
be replaced. The cylinder must be replaced
if it shows striping due to a seizure.
10 - Use a section of an old ring (29) to carefully
clean the inside of the piston (24) ring housings, en-
suring that the oil passage holes are not blocked.
11 - To check the wear in the piston ring housings,
t a new ring and measure the residual space with
a feeler gauge (30). The piston must be replaced
if it is greater than 0.12 mm in the two compression
ring housings.
12 - Use a screwdriver to remove the clamping ring
(31) and remove the gudgeon pin (32) from the
piston (24).
